On Thu, 2012-09-20 at 23:10 +0200, Werner Detter wrote: > The policyd-weight package in stable should be updated as it still uses a > non functional DNSBL. Furthermore the DNSBL's from rfc-ignorant.org will > be shut down on 2012-11-30 (the announcement from the lists operator can > be found here: http://rfc-ignorant.org/endofanera.php) > > To prevent false positives with those DNSBL's I'd like to update the stable > package. I've backported two patches from the policyd-weight package in > in unstable/testing: > > 03_del_non_func_ipv6_dnsbl.dpatch > 04_del_rfc-ignorant.org.patch.dpatch
